2000 Chrysler Town & Country Overview
Introduction
Chrysler invented the minivan in the early 1980s.Ten years later, it invented the luxury minivan, the Town & Country.As we begin the new millennium, the Town & Country continues to set the pace for the minivan pack, whether we're talking about styling, comfort, spaciousness or ride quality.In fact, the Chrysler Town & Country's refinements and amenities are so plentiful that it can square off with many luxury sedans.And that includes ride quality, because the Town & Country purrs along like a sedan.
Chrysler offers varying minivan configurations to suit different types of buyers.Until this year, Chrysler has always given buyers a choice among three nameplates -- Chrysler Town & Country, Plymouth Voyager and Dodge Caravan.But the Plymouth nameplate has been retired, so the Voyager lives on as the Chrysler Voyager.
